CAMBRIDGE – “If we have learned anything about the McGuinty-Wynne Liberals, it is that they have a proven track record of losing manufacturing jobs,” said Ontario PC MPP Rob Leone.
Leone’s comments follow the news that 4,200 families lost their jobs in Waterloo Region in March. It marked the 87th consecutive month that Ontario’s unemployment rate was above the national average.
“Right now, we have a government that isn’t creating jobs for people,” said Leone. “Last month, when families should have been looking forward to March Break, they were 20,000 men and women looking for a job. We need to change this.”
The Ontario PC Caucus has put forward a plan to create jobs by lowering taxes, making hydro rates more affordable and reducing the red-tape businesses face.
